          Hitler did come to power when Germany was in economic crisis and Hitler
          took advantage promising a "better economy". The economic crisis in
          Germany was due to the unjust conditions which were placed on Germany
          for supposedly "Attacking" the world during World War I and because of
          it, Germans became bitter towards other nations and was one of the
          reasons why World War II resulted.
